http://www.dfg.ca.gov/marine/pdfs/oceanfish2008.pdf One daily limit in possession weather frozen, preserved yadda yadda. He flat out said only one daily limit at ANY time. And that technically goes all the way to your freezer. When the limit goes to 3 then you can legally have three in the freezer. He said you don't want to be showing up at the dock with 3 WSB in your cooler from a 3 day camping trip. And a multiday permit does not jive if you are setting foot on land between days. What I did not question was how a multiday permit DOES seem to contradict the possession rule. Unless it just overides it completely. Here's the contact persons info I got after emailing DFG central.
